Step 1: Assessment and Emergency Services
We’ll arrive at your store within 60 minutes to assess the damage and provide emergency services, including water extraction and containment. Our goal is to prevent further damage and protect your property.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
Our team will use truck-mounted extractors to remove standing water from your store, followed by industrial-grade drying systems to dry the affected areas. This process is critical to preventing mold growth and secondary dam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ade drying systems and dehumidifiers to dry the affected are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ings. Our equipment is designed to remove moisture and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the drying process is complete, our team will clean and sanitize the affected areas to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. This step is crucial to ensuring your store is safe and healthy for customers.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, our team will work with you to restore and reconstruct your store to its original condition, including replacing damaged materials and fixtures. Our goal is to make your store look and feel like new.

Retail Store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water damage is widespread and affects multiple areas of the store. | No | Yes | A professional team has the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water damage restoration. |
| Water damage is confined to a small area and is easily accessible. | Yes | No | In this case, DIY water extraction and drying may be enough, but be sure to follow proper safety protocols. |
| Water damage is suspected, but no visible signs are present. | No | Yes | A professional team can detect hidden water damage and prevent further problems. |
| Water damage is affecting electrical systems or appliances. | No | Yes | Electrical water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age is causing musty odors or mold growth. | No | Yes | A professional team has the equipment and expertise to remove mold and prevent further growth. |
| Water damage is affecting insulation or structural elements. | No | Yes | A professional team can assess and address damage to insulation and structural elements to prevent further problems. |

How do I prevent water damage in my store?
To prevent water damage in your store, make sure to:
- Inspect your pipes and fixtures regularly for signs of wear and tear.
- Fix leaks quickly to prevent water damage.
- Use a sump pump and backup system to prevent flooding.
- Keep your store clean and dry to prevent mold growth.
